New Online Ojek Fares Starts at 10th September

8th September 2022 – Through the Ministry of Transportation, the Government has officially set a new online ojek fares after the fuel oil price hike. The new fares will be effective three days from the date of its stipulation or 10th September.

The decision to raise the online ojek fares has been postponed for quite a while. The Ministry of Transportation, Budi Karya Sumadi, has clarified the steps the Ministry has taken to handle the impact of the fuel oil price hike in the transportation sector.

Additionally, it is done following the announcement of the implementation policy of diverting fuel subsidies to more targeted assistance by President Joko Widodo on Saturday (3/9).

In order for the implementation to go smoothly, Sumadi has asked the Director General of Road Transportation, Hendro Sugiatno to keep communicating with online ojek drivers and applicators.

Sugiatno said that the adjustment of online ojek fares is done with the consideration of fuel oil price, regional minimum wage (UMR), and other service calculations.

There will also be changes in the rental application fee to 15 percent, which was previously set at 20 percent.

The new online ojek fares are set in three zones, with the first zone covering Sumatra, and Java, except Jabodetabek and Bali. The second zone is Jabodetabek and the third zone covers Kalimantan, Sulawesi, Nusa Tenggara, Maluku and Papua.

The minimum base fares in the Jabodetabek area increases by 13 percent while its maximum base fares increases by 6 percent. Meanwhile, for the first zone, the minimum base fares raises by 8 percent while its maximum base fares raises by 8,7 percent. And lastly, for the third zone, 9,5 percent raise in the minimum fares and 5,7 percent for the maximum.

The New Online Ojek Fares

Zone 1 (Sumatra, Java, Bali)

Minimum Base Fare: IDR 2,000/km

Maximum Base Fare: IDR 2,500/km

Service Fee: IDR 8,000 – 10,000

Zone 2 (Jabodetabek)

Minimum Base Fare: IDR 2,550/km

Maximum Base Fare: IDR 2,800/km

Service Fee: IDR 10,200 – 11,200

Zone 3 (Other areas)

Minimum Base Fare: IDR 2,300/km

Maximum Base Fare: IDR 2,750/km

Service Fee: IDR 9,000 – 11,000
